Player Voice 1.2
765
32
765
32
Description:
The PlayerVoice script enhances the gameplay experience by adding dynamic audio responses for the player character. This script plays custom audio clips based on various in-game actions such as combat, aiming, bumping into NPCs, car crashes, and weapon reloading. It supports personalized configurations for different player models and integrates lip-sync animations to provide a more immersive experience.
Changelogs:
1.0
-Initial Release.
1.1
- Added Car Jacking Responses.
1.2
- Combat Audio Logic Improved (No more Audio When Firing a weapon without a valid target)
- Aim Audio Will only Play when wanted level is less than 3 (Same as protagonists Franklin/Micheal/Trevor)
Key Features:
Combat Responses: Plays random audio clips from a designated folder when the player is shooting or performing melee combat.
Aiming Responses: Triggers audio feedback when the player aims at an NPC.
Bump Responses: Plays a sound when the player bumps into NPCs, with a cooldown to prevent spamming.
Car Crash Responses: Plays audio when the player’s car collides NPCs Vehicles and NPCs on foot.
Car Jacking Responses: Plays audio when the player is jacking a vehicle from an NPC.
Weapon Reloading Responses: Provides audio feedback during weapon reloading actions.
Lip-Sync Animation: Syncs the player character’s lip movements with audio playback for a realistic effect.
Configuration: Easily configurable via an INI file, allowing you to set different audio folders and volume levels for different player models.
Installation:
-Place the all files into your scripts folder.
-Edit the PlayerVoice.ini file to configure NPCs and their voices.
-Create the folder for your character. Give the folder path in the ini.
-Launch the game and enjoy!
Requirements:
-Script Hook V
-Script Hook V .NET
The PlayerVoice script enhances the gameplay experience by adding dynamic audio responses for the player character. This script plays custom audio clips based on various in-game actions such as combat, aiming, bumping into NPCs, car crashes, and weapon reloading. It supports personalized configurations for different player models and integrates lip-sync animations to provide a more immersive experience.
Changelogs:
1.0
-Initial Release.
1.1
- Added Car Jacking Responses.
1.2
- Combat Audio Logic Improved (No more Audio When Firing a weapon without a valid target)
- Aim Audio Will only Play when wanted level is less than 3 (Same as protagonists Franklin/Micheal/Trevor)
Key Features:
Combat Responses: Plays random audio clips from a designated folder when the player is shooting or performing melee combat.
Aiming Responses: Triggers audio feedback when the player aims at an NPC.
Bump Responses: Plays a sound when the player bumps into NPCs, with a cooldown to prevent spamming.
Car Crash Responses: Plays audio when the player’s car collides NPCs Vehicles and NPCs on foot.
Car Jacking Responses: Plays audio when the player is jacking a vehicle from an NPC.
Weapon Reloading Responses: Provides audio feedback during weapon reloading actions.
Lip-Sync Animation: Syncs the player character’s lip movements with audio playback for a realistic effect.
Configuration: Easily configurable via an INI file, allowing you to set different audio folders and volume levels for different player models.
Installation:
-Place the all files into your scripts folder.
-Edit the PlayerVoice.ini file to configure NPCs and their voices.
-Create the folder for your character. Give the folder path in the ini.
-Launch the game and enjoy!
Requirements:
-Script Hook V
-Script Hook V .NET
First Uploaded: Martes 27 de Agosto de 2024
Last Updated: Venres 30 de Agosto de 2024
Last Downloaded: 5 horas
47 Comments
More mods by GogetaSsj4:
Description:
The PlayerVoice script enhances the gameplay experience by adding dynamic audio responses for the player character. This script plays custom audio clips based on various in-game actions such as combat, aiming, bumping into NPCs, car crashes, and weapon reloading. It supports personalized configurations for different player models and integrates lip-sync animations to provide a more immersive experience.
Changelogs:
1.0
-Initial Release.
1.1
- Added Car Jacking Responses.
1.2
- Combat Audio Logic Improved (No more Audio When Firing a weapon without a valid target)
- Aim Audio Will only Play when wanted level is less than 3 (Same as protagonists Franklin/Micheal/Trevor)
Key Features:
Combat Responses: Plays random audio clips from a designated folder when the player is shooting or performing melee combat.
Aiming Responses: Triggers audio feedback when the player aims at an NPC.
Bump Responses: Plays a sound when the player bumps into NPCs, with a cooldown to prevent spamming.
Car Crash Responses: Plays audio when the player’s car collides NPCs Vehicles and NPCs on foot.
Car Jacking Responses: Plays audio when the player is jacking a vehicle from an NPC.
Weapon Reloading Responses: Provides audio feedback during weapon reloading actions.
Lip-Sync Animation: Syncs the player character’s lip movements with audio playback for a realistic effect.
Configuration: Easily configurable via an INI file, allowing you to set different audio folders and volume levels for different player models.
Installation:
-Place the all files into your scripts folder.
-Edit the PlayerVoice.ini file to configure NPCs and their voices.
-Create the folder for your character. Give the folder path in the ini.
-Launch the game and enjoy!
Requirements:
-Script Hook V
-Script Hook V .NET
The PlayerVoice script enhances the gameplay experience by adding dynamic audio responses for the player character. This script plays custom audio clips based on various in-game actions such as combat, aiming, bumping into NPCs, car crashes, and weapon reloading. It supports personalized configurations for different player models and integrates lip-sync animations to provide a more immersive experience.
Changelogs:
1.0
-Initial Release.
1.1
- Added Car Jacking Responses.
1.2
- Combat Audio Logic Improved (No more Audio When Firing a weapon without a valid target)
- Aim Audio Will only Play when wanted level is less than 3 (Same as protagonists Franklin/Micheal/Trevor)
Key Features:
Combat Responses: Plays random audio clips from a designated folder when the player is shooting or performing melee combat.
Aiming Responses: Triggers audio feedback when the player aims at an NPC.
Bump Responses: Plays a sound when the player bumps into NPCs, with a cooldown to prevent spamming.
Car Crash Responses: Plays audio when the player’s car collides NPCs Vehicles and NPCs on foot.
Car Jacking Responses: Plays audio when the player is jacking a vehicle from an NPC.
Weapon Reloading Responses: Provides audio feedback during weapon reloading actions.
Lip-Sync Animation: Syncs the player character’s lip movements with audio playback for a realistic effect.
Configuration: Easily configurable via an INI file, allowing you to set different audio folders and volume levels for different player models.
Installation:
-Place the all files into your scripts folder.
-Edit the PlayerVoice.ini file to configure NPCs and their voices.
-Create the folder for your character. Give the folder path in the ini.
-Launch the game and enjoy!
Requirements:
-Script Hook V
-Script Hook V .NET
First Uploaded: Martes 27 de Agosto de 2024
Last Updated: Venres 30 de Agosto de 2024
Last Downloaded: 5 horas
@GogetaSsj4 what about freemode female character?will it work.freemod mp female talk less....
@GogetaSsj4 Could you please tell me how to check/set the default output device? I only have the Realtek Digital Output and the TV Audio (listed as Nvidia HD Audio). I use the Realktek digital (the sound of the speakers I have for my PC) and it's listed first, but idk if it is the default one.
Thank you! Hopefully you consider adding more triggers such as when stuck in traffic (tie with horn), combat barks outside of shooting/melee combat when Player is close to combative NPC at a frequency set between 2 time integers, pinned down/suppressed state. Some sort of speech wheel for the Player to select voice lines on demand would be great. Perhaps you’ll consider actually using the game’s own system for voice lines and have your script trigger the various groups of voice lines set for models in the game.
@GogetaSsj4 Hi again. I already set my Realtek Audio as the default one in Windows Control Panel, but the voices still won't work. :/
@CJislit Strange mod works on all of my systems. do you have the latest scripthookvdotnet nightly
@GogetaSsj4 Nope, I don't, but I figured out the issue: I didn't change the "player_tommy" from every line in the ini file. I did it and now everything works.
Thanks for the mod! It is great. I'll stay tuned for when you add more situations for the peds to use the voices. =D
Also, a heads up for anyone that needs it: if you use the Character Swap (or similar) mod to change the hashes of a ped model to use it as one of the main 3 characters, you need to make folders/ino changes in this mod for player zero/one/two and not the ped model you will use. once you swap the hash of the model to one of the 3 protagonists, the voices of this mod used will be the ones of the folder of the protagonist you're using.
@CJislit is this also for frank or michael or any character i want?
@Mauluskus It is for any character (ped) you want, you just need to make the folders and the correct changes in the ini file using the ped model name as it exist in the game files.
If you use the Character Swap mod, the voices used will be the ones asigned to the model you're using the hash of.
@CJislit Haha. And i was trying to look for the issues xD. I am glad it worked :D
Mod idea! In the base game, if a vehicle or a plane explodes, all the passengers die instantly. It would be kind of cool if, like in real life, you could shoot down a plane and there was a chance that some of the passengers might survive. :D
Suggestion for how this could work:
- When the plane or helicopter explodes or catches fire and starts to crash, the passengers are temporarily made invincible, and forced to stay in the vehicle so they can't jump out.
- When the vehicle hits the ground, the invincibility is removed, and a random amount of damage is applied to each seat - so, for example, Passenger A might take lose 300 health, which is fatal; Passenger B might lose 150 health, which leaves him very badly injured, but still barely alive; and Passenger C might take 25 damage, which is minimal, and he's mostly fine. But it's randomised, so in theory all of them could die, or none of them - each crash is different.
- Once the vehicle crash-lands and comes to a stop, survivors able to climb out and continue as normal peds.
I think it could create cool scenarios, where you shoot down a chopper or a plane, and it crashes in the distance, and when you go over to it, there are a couple of survivors still ready to fight you. :D
Bonus but less important features:
- Blood decals for survivors, all bloodied and bashed
- One of the in-game limp animations
(They're not that important, just might add a bit of immersion)
@CoronaPrime I tried to do this but for someone reason godmode is not being activated at the right time. I will try to implement some other logic
If the problem is that they die when the vehicle is destroyed, idk if this is any help to you, but this mod causes planes to go down dramatically when they lose health - might be of some use?: https://www.gta5-mods.com/scripts/realistic-plane-crash-secretic
Hi
Thank you for your great mod but It doesn't work
I changed inifile but character doesn't play the voice
Lipsynch doesn't work too
Is there something missing?
Sorry...
My scripthookV wasn't nightlyversion
This is great mod big thanks
@GogetaSsj4 Hey, there. Are you still planning to update this mod with more voice triggers? =D
@CJislit I want to but not getting enough time for that at the moment.
Hi, could you add the talk button (d-pad)? Anyway thanks for the mod because I can't get the voiceplayer mod to work.
Sorry for my bad English.
if ai put on Player 1 this message appears: The following message appears in the game above the mini map: Unhandled exception in the "PlayerVoice" script!
FileNotFoundException in PlayerVoice.PlayAudioWithLip Sync(String filePath, PlayerVoiceConfig config)
if ai put in player 3 notting happens... :(
do u know how to uninstall this mod? i already deleted it from scripts but it kept showing on my screen when i pressed E key, thanks